
访谈及书摘:Thomas Erl的《SOA设计模式》
3月,InfoQ发布了Thomas Erl的新书(《SOA设计模式》)的摘录,并借此机会采访了作者。话题涉及模式目录(patterns catalog)的作用,面向服务、SOA和Web服务三者之间的区别,以及SOA世界的现状。

3月,InfoQ发布了Thomas Erl的新书(《SOA设计模式》)的摘录,并借此机会采访了作者。话题涉及模式目录(patterns catalog)的作用,面向服务、SOA和Web服务三者之间的区别,以及SOA世界的现状。
运用现有的各样各样的远程机制,通常有必要以一种支持交换/引入新协议而不会或者最少化对客户端实现造成影响的方式来构建客户端。一个新的构架-CRISPY-即提供了对这一实现的支持。

现在已经很少再有纯粹封闭式的应用,对数据库的依赖,对存储的依赖以及对第三方系统的依赖都是我们在设计系统架构时要考虑的问题。本文试图通过分析Tomcat和JBoss中的异步服务处理来降低依赖所带来的风险。

本视频对SOA在互联网系统中的应用进行了探讨,主要以支付宝在SOA的实践为例,主题从敏捷的应用程序(对象与组件)到敏捷的企业系统(应用集成与面向服务),再到敏捷的生态圈(网关与开放平台)。

在QCon伦敦2008的这次采访中,Amazon Web Services(AWS)的传道者Jeff Barr讨论了SimpleDB、S3、EC2、SQS、云计算、Amazon的不同服务如何与应用交互、AWS的起源、SimpleDB和微软SQL Server Data Services、AWS cloud的全球化、三月份的AWS停机、SimpleDB存储过程以及AMIs与VMWare之间的互相转换。

InfoQ中文站有幸与谷歌的资深工程师谷雪梅女士在一起探讨了云计算的相关话题,包括云计算的概念、它与网格计算和公用计算的异同、云计算的优势、虚拟化在其中扮演的角色、App Engine等等。